This happened to me also, took awhile to figure out. Game is the breed, just like Wyandotte or Sussex are breeds. It's a very old breed, so it's confusing. There is an American Game and an Old English Game (OEG). The other names you are seeing are 'strains' or 'lines' but they don't matter unless you intend to show them at competitions. They are all the same breed. If you'd like to know what strain you have, there is a great thread for that in the Gamefowl area.
So-
Species: Chicken
Breed: Gamefowl
Strain: Kelso or Sweater or Roundhead or other...
Line: Jimmy John Joe or Mick Smith or other...
Also, this is totally, completely different from 'Gamebirds' like Turkey or Pheasants, which are different species, with their own various breeds.
